Rickelton Responds to Snub with Stunning Ton for MI Cape Town

p Rickelton, seemingly spurred by recent oversights from the national squad, delivered a breathtaking performance against the Paarl Royals, crafting a magnificent innings that effectively steered MI Cape Town to a significant victory. The batsman appeared unfazed by the perceived slight, launching into a display of aggressive hitting, decorated the boundary with boundaries and six’s. His effort of 102 runs, boasting eleven fours and four maximums, was a clear declaration of his ambition and a potent reminder of his talent. The audience at Newlands were shown a genuine game, with Rickelton’s aggressive attack dominating the match.
